The U.S. Ranking System is somewhat straightforward with there being a total of 10 officer grades (discounting a special segment called the Warrant Officer Program), and 9 Enlisted grades. Warrant Officers The Warrant Officer program allows technically trained individuals with specific command authority to command missions of key importance in combat or in administrative tasks. An excellent example of a warrant officer is one who has trained as a helicopter pilot, and thus commands his aircraft and crew.
Enlisted
U.S. Army
Enlisted
- E-1 - Private (recruit) (no chevron)
- E-2 - Private (after basic)
- E-3 - Private 1st Class (1 chevron)
- E-4 - Corporal (2 chevrons) (includes Specialist 4)
NCOs
- E-5 - Sergeant (3 chevrons)
- E-6 - Staff Sergeant (3 Chevrons 1 below )
- E-7 - Sergeant First Class (3 chevrons above 2 below)
- E-8 - First Sergeant (3 chevrons above 3 below) (Master Sergeant)
- E-9 - Sergeant Major (3 chevrons above 3 below, star center) (Sergeant Major of the Army and Command Sergeant Major)
U.S. MarinesEnlisted
- E-1 - Private (recruit) (no chevron)
- E-2 - Private First Class (1 chevron)
- E-3 - Lance Corporal (1 Chevron, crossed rifles)
NCOs
- E-4 - Corporal (2 chevrons, crossed rifles)
- E-5 - Sergeant (3 chevrons, crossed rifles)
- E-6 - Staff Sergeant (3 Chevrons 1 below, crossed rifles)
- E-7 - Gunnery Sergeant (3 chevrons above 2 below, crossed rif.)
- E-8 - Master Sergeant (3 chevrons above 3 below, with crossed rif.)
- E-8 - First Sergeant (3 chevrons above 3 below, with diamond)
- E-9 - Master Gunnery Sergeant(3 chevrons above 4 below, Palm Frond in center)
- E-9 - Sergeant Major (3 above 4 below, star in center)
U.S. NavySeaman
- E-1 - Seaman Recruit (1 diagonal hash marks)
- E-2 - Seaman Apprentice (2 diagonal hash marks)
- E-3 - Seaman (3 diagonal hash marks)
NCOs
- E-4 - Petty Officer Third Class (Eagle and 1 lower stripe)
- E-5 - Petty Officer Second Class (Eagle and 2 lower stripes)
- E-6 - Petty Officer First Class (Eagle and 3 lower stripes)
- E-7 - Chief Petty Officer (Eagle, stripe above, 3 stripes below)
- E-8 - Senior Chief Petty Officer (Star, Eagle, stripe above, 3 below)
- E-9 - Master Chief Petty Officer (2 Stars, Eagle, stripe above, 3 below)
